pandas 如何保存数据到excel,csv
作者:呆萌的代Ma 发布时间:2021-05-12 13:05:22
标签:pandas,保存数据,excel,csv
pandas 保存数据到excel,csv
pandas 保存数据比较简单
对于任意一个dataframe:
import pandas as pd
import numpy as np
dataframe = pd.DataFrame(data=np.random.random(size=(10, 10)))
导入到excel中
dataframe.to_excel("文件.xlsx")
导入到csv中
dataframe.to_csv("文件.csv")
更细致的操作
可以添加更多的参数,比如:
dataframe.to_excel("文件.xlsx", index=False, header=None)
index=False
,代表不会导出index,就是最左侧的那一列header=None
,代表不会导出第一行,也就是列头
对于csv,还有常用操作:
dataframe.to_csv("文件.csv",sep=',')
sep设置分隔符,这样,每列之间会用“,”隔开,如果改为sep="$",那么两个数据间就会用$符号隔开
将数据保存到csv或者xlsx中的最基本操作
pandas提供了非常方便的函数,能够将数据保存到cvs或者xlsx中。
import pandas as pd
import numpy as np
import pymysql
from sqlalchemy import create_engine
import openpyxl
pdata = pd.read_csv('tips.csv')
df = pdata.to_csv('out.csv')
print(df)
这里我首先读取tips.csv的数据放在了pdata变量中,然后使用
pdata.to_csv(‘out.csv’)将数据保存为‘out.csv’文件中。
这里只介绍这一个参数。若只填文件名,则默认是该python文件的目录下,也可以使用绝对地址。
若不填该参数,则df返回值为string类型的pdata数据。
若填该参数,pd返回值为None
pdata.to_excel('out.xlsx',sheet_name="sheetname",index=False)
第一个参数为保存的文件名,注意,不能为空
sheet_name
设置excel文件脚注index=False
这个意思是不将索引写入到文件中
来源:https://blog.csdn.net/weixin_35757704/article/details/88180581


猜你喜欢
- kNN(k-nearest neighbor)是一种基本的分类与回归的算法。这里我们先只讨论分类中的kNN算法。k邻近算法的输入为实例的特征
- 众所周知,FileSystemObject(fso)组件的强大功能及破坏性是它屡屡被免费主页提供商(那些支持ASP)的禁用的原因,我整理了一
- 可以不依靠DSN,但又可以在数据库连接字符串中指定驱动程序、服务器名字、数据库、数据库账号和密码吗?可以。在SQL Server 7,使用这
- Django中获取text,password名字:<input type="text" name="na
- 序言这不是圣诞节快到了,准备让让女朋友开心开心,也算是亲手做的,稍稍花了点心思。话不多说,咱们直接来展示吧,学会了赶紧画给你的那个她吧!本文
- JQuery,mootools,Ext等类库在这部分实现得非常艰辛,盘根错节地动用一大堆方法,因此想把这部分抠出来难度很大。深入研究它们的实
- 一次又一次的,我发现,那些有bug的Javascript代码是由于没有真正理解Javascript函数是如何工作而导致的(顺便说一下,许多那
- 在 MySQL下,在进行中文模糊检索时,经常会返回一些与之不相关的记录,如查找 "%a%" 时,返回的可能有中文字符,却
- 本文实例讲述了python读取json文件并将数据插入到mongodb的方法。分享给大家供大家参考。具体实现方法如下:#coding=utf
- 使用Vue来实现鼠标悬停效果。可以使用事件处理器v-on指令(简写为:@)来完成。为标签绑定mouseenter以及mouseleave事件
- 前言日常开发中,我们使用mysql来实现分页功能的时候,总是会用到mysql的limit语法.而怎么使用却很有讲究的,今天来总结一下.lim
- 大家好,我是辣条。前言今天带来爬虫实战的第30篇文章。在挑选游戏的过程中感受学习,让你突飞猛进。python爬虫实战:steam逆向RSA登
- 在之前的工作中,业务方做了一些调整,提出了对一部分核心指标做更细致的拆分并定期产出的需求。出于某些原因,这部分数据不太方便在报表上呈现,因此
- 第三章 XML的术语提纲:导言 一.XML文档的有关术语 二.DTD的有关术语导言初学XML最令人头疼的就是有一大堆新的术语概念要理解。由于
- 本文实例讲述了Python实现Windows上气泡提醒效果的方法。分享给大家供大家参考。具体实现方法如下:# -*- encoding: g
- 如下所示:#!/usr/bin/env python#-*- coding: utf-8 -*-"""[0,
- PDOStatement::bindValuePDOStatement::bindValue — 把一个值绑定到一个参数(PHP 5 >
- 一。安装python1.到python官网下载安装包注意:班级同学们请到班级资料下载安装包,可以不用到网上下载。点击导航栏download-
- 本文实例讲述了Python django框架应用中实现获取访问者ip地址。分享给大家供大家参考,具体如下:在django官方文档中有一段对r
- 前言首先,一个常见的问题是,ECMAScript 和 JavaScript 到底是什么关系?ECMAScript是一个国际通过的标准化脚本语